Choose seat depths that match your posture habits; 21–24 inches suits most reading and conversation. Curved arms cradle without boxing you in. Modular sections adapt to gatherings yet split for cleaning. Upholster two pieces differently within one palette for layered calm. Oval dining tables erase the politics of corners and improve circulation. Rounded coffee tables reduce shin collisions and soften geometry near sofas. Select tops in solid wood or honed stone for tactile honesty. Keep finishes forgiving; life happens. Style simply—one tray, one book stack, one flower moment—so surfaces remain ready for board games, work bursts, or weekend croissants.
Clutter is loud; storage hushes. Built-ins with push-latch doors, low credenzas, and woven baskets catch life’s extras without scolding. Use a color-matched finish to let storage recede into architecture. Label invisibly inside. Adopt a five-minute nightly sweep ritual; what cannot be stored kindly likely does not belong.
